What do those indecline stickers mean?

Indecline could be described as a guerrilla film crew that produced a series of controversial dvds in 2005-06 called "bumfights" they would pay homeless people money, liquor, drugs, ect to fight, then they would film it. They also filmed random street fights, teenagers or themselves or others fighting, skate boarding, tagging (graffiti), illegal activities, ect. It is kind of like the show "Jack" only lower budget and the main focus is filming fights. The indecline stickers are their logo. posting them everywhere seems like a parody of propaganda, giving viral media a physical presence out of the digital world. some consider them to be street art (the new term for graffiti...)
